Back to top

01 8300 600

Calls charged at national rate.

Loading...

3 items found for Sports Polo Shirts

ellesse Rooks Polo
Sale

ellesse Rooks Polo

Save €18.50

Was €57.50

€39.00

adidas 3 Stripes Pique Polo

adidas 3 Stripes Pique Polo

€46.00

adidas 3 Stripes Polo Shirt
Sale

adidas 3 Stripes Polo Shirt

Save €13.50

Was €46.00

€32.50